Care and Cleaning

Like most appliances, your water dispenser requires periodic maintenance for maximum efficiency and performance, and must be cleaned
on a regular basis (i.e. every 4 months). To maintain a hygienic environment within your water dispenser and prevent potential formation
(growth) of bacteria, we strongly recommend regular cleaning. A cleaning kit is available through our Customer Service Department at
1-877-527-0313 or can be ordered online at www.homedepot.com.
WarninG: Unplug the dispenser before performing any of the following cleaning procedures.
cLEANING THE OUTSIDE OF THE WATER DISPENSER
The outside of the dispenser can be wiped clean with a mild soap and water mixture. Never use har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ners. Rinse
thoroughly with clean water and then dry surfaces.
cLEANING THE DRIP TRAY
To remove the drip tray, pull the tray forward, dislodging it from the guides. Drain and
clean. The drip tray should be emptied and cleaned regularly to remove spotting and any
mineral deposits. Clean with a water dispenser cleaning solution (not included) or a mild
soap and water mixture. For tough deposits, add vinegar and let it soak until the deposits
come loose. Then wash, rinse, and dry thoroughly. To replace, put the grill back on the
drip tray and slide the tray onto the guides (not dishwasher safe).
cLEANING THE cONDENSER
Vacuum or sweep away the dust from the condenser coils at the back of the dispenser. For best results, you can purchase a brush designed
specifically for this purpose from your local appliance store. This will improve cooling and efficiency.
DRAINING THE RESERvOIRS
Drain the reservoirs before and after cleaning, when going on long vacations, or if not using the dispenser for long periods of time.
CaUTiOn: Unplug the dispenser before performing this procedure. Dispense hot water until temperature drops to a safe level to avoid
the risk of scalding.
□ Remove the water bottle.
□ Press both dispensing buttons until water no longer comes out.
□ Place a bucket beneath the drain valve on the back of the dispenser.
□ Remove the cap and plug from the drain valve, and let the water flow into the bucket. Replace the cap and plug. (A screwdriver or coin
can be used to help loosen the drain cap.)
iMPOrTanT: Collect the water in a container, not the drip tray.
□ Replace the water bottle (see "Installing the Water Bottle").
GOING AWAY ON vAcATION
When not using the dispenser for long periods of time, or when going on vacation, conserve energy by unplugging the dispenser and drain-
ing the reservoirs (see "Draining the Reservoirs"). Upon return, follow the initial product cleaning procedures before using the dispenser.
